bvocruise Posted February 2, 2020 #1 Share Posted February 2, 2020 Can anyone recommend a tour from the Canada Place cruise terminal that drops off at the airport? Our flight is at 5:15. Rare martincath Posted February 2, 2020 #2 Share Posted February 2, 2020 I'm pretty sure that BC Passport is just a reseller - and based on descriptions and prices they are not charging extra, but are still using the typical big players like WestCoast and LandSea, plus HarbourAir for floatplanes, BC Ferries etc. From skimming a few parts of their site it looks more up-to-date than many similar ones at least, though there's still out-of-date pricing page-to-page - like bus tours that pick up at Ballantyne pier which closed al most 5 years ago for cruising, as well as a few bits of misinformation (e.g. "Canadian beer is stronger" is a myth caused by the US using ABW instead of ABV for many years, which makes for a 24% differential in the number between beers with identical alcohol content) So why not go direct instead? If anything goes screwy you deal directly with the people concerned instead of waiting for a go-between to get back to you, and all the money you pay actually pays the tour provider. The 'city highlights' tour with drop at airport looks like LandSeas 10am post-cruise tour (same stops and inclusions), and the only other viable tours that would get you safely to YVR by 3pm would be another LandSea resell, their 'Peak and Canyon' 5 hr tour at 9am (personally I think this is the single worst bus tour offered by anyone, as you just barely have enough time at Cap to hustle over the bridge, treewalk and cliffwalk and ~2 hours at Grouse is just insanely short of the needed time - that's a 5+ hour attraction if you do it independently, there is a ton of stuff including many shows which only happen a few times daily. Plus, both attractions have free shuttles - so you could EASILY do Grouse for a fraction of the price and do it justice, or else do Cap and something else downtown for a couple of hours instead). Personally, given how easy it is to get to the airport independently, how cheap it is to store bags at the pier, and how inefficient ALL of the timeslots are for post-cruise tours I'd recommend just doing your own thing. Even if you want to take a cab rather than SkyTrain, you're looking at ~$40 incl tip shared among up to 4 people for the transport; $5 a bag to store at the Pan Pacific hotel bell desk, which you literally walk right past on the way out of the pier; and if you self-disembark you can get in a full two extra hours of sightseeing compared to when the post-cruise bus tours start (10am). This makes HOHO tours pretty enticing - only get off where you want, for as long as you want, instead of being forced to waste 45mins on Granville Island (not enough to actually explore it properly, but far more time than needed to grab a souvenir or some food at the public market) for example, which most of the City Highlight tours include.
